See the * GNU General Public License for more details: * * Copyright (C) 2015 Azimut Electronics * * Author: Aleksander Morgado */ #include #include "mm-errors-types.h" #include "mm-bearer-stats.h" /** * SECTION: mm-bearer-stats * @title: MMBearerStats * @short_description: Helper object to handle bearer stats. * * The #MMBearerStats is an object handling the statistics reported by the * bearer object during a connection. * * This object is retrieved with either mm_bearer_get_stats() or * mm_bearer_peek_stats(). */ G_DEFINE_TYPE (MMBearerStats, mm_bearer_stats, G_TYPE_OBJECT) #define PROPERTY_DURATION "duration" #define PROPERTY_RX_BYTES "rx-bytes" #define PROPERTY_TX_BYTES "tx-bytes" struct _MMBearerStatsPrivate { guint duration; guint64 rx_bytes; guint64 tx_bytes; }; /*****************************************************************************/ /** * mm_bearer_stats_get_duration: * @self: a #MMBearerStats. * * Gets the duration of the current connection, in seconds. * * Returns: a #guint. */ guint mm_bearer_stats_get_duration (MMBearerStats *self) { g_return_val_if_fail (MM_IS_BEARER_STATS (self), 0); return self->priv->duration; } void mm_bearer_stats_set_duration (MMBearerStats *self, guint duration) { g_return_if_fail (MM_IS_BEARER_STATS (self)); self->priv->duration = duration; } /*****************************************************************************/ /** * mm_bearer_stats_get_rx_bytes: * @self: a #MMBearerStats. * * Gets the number of bytes received without error in the connection. * * Returns: a #guint64. */ guint64 mm_bearer_stats_get_rx_bytes (MMBearerStats *self) { g_return_val_if_fail (MM_IS_BEARER_STATS (self), 0); return self->priv->rx_bytes; } void mm_bearer_stats_set_rx_bytes (MMBearerStats *self, guint64 bytes) { g_return_if_fail (MM_IS_BEARER_STATS (self)); self->priv->rx_bytes = bytes; } /*****************************************************************************/ /** * mm_bearer_stats_get_tx_bytes: * @self: a #MMBearerStats. * * Gets the number of bytes transmitted without error in the connection. * * Returns: a #guint64. */ guint64 mm_bearer_stats_get_tx_bytes (MMBearerStats *self) { g_return_val_if_fail (MM_IS_BEARER_STATS (self), 0); return self->priv->tx_bytes; } void mm_bearer_stats_set_tx_bytes (MMBearerStats *self, guint64 bytes) { g_return_if_fail (MM_IS_BEARER_STATS (self)); self->priv->tx_bytes = bytes; } /*****************************************************************************/ GVariant * mm_bearer_stats_get_dictionary (MMBearerStats *self) { GVariantBuilder builder; /* We do allow self==NULL. We'll just report NULL. */ if (!self) return NULL; g_variant_builder_init (&builder, G_VARIANT_TYPE ("a{sv}")); g_variant_builder_add (&builder, "{sv}", PROPERTY_DURATION, g_variant_new_uint32 (self->priv->duration)); g_variant_builder_add (&builder, "{sv}", PROPERTY_RX_BYTES, g_variant_new_uint64 (self->priv->rx_bytes)); g_variant_builder_add (&builder, "{sv}", PROPERTY_TX_BYTES, g_variant_new_uint64 (self->priv->tx_bytes)); return g_variant_builder_end (&builder); } /*****************************************************************************/ MMBearerStats * mm_bearer_stats_new_from_dictionary (GVariant *dictionary, GError **error) { GVariantIter iter; gchar *key; GVariant *value; MMBearerStats *self; self = mm_bearer_stats_new (); if (!dictionary) return self; if (!g_variant_is_of_type (dictionary, G_VARIANT_TYPE ("a{sv}"))) { g_set_error (error, MM_CORE_ERROR, MM_CORE_ERROR_INVALID_ARGS, "Cannot create Stats from dictionary: " "invalid variant type received"); g_object_unref (self); return NULL; } g_variant_iter_init (&iter, dictionary); while (g_variant_iter_next (&iter, "{sv}", &key, &value)) { if (g_str_equal (key, PROPERTY_DURATION)) { mm_bearer_stats_set_duration ( self, g_variant_get_uint32 (value)); } else if (g_str_equal (key, PROPERTY_RX_BYTES)) { mm_bearer_stats_set_rx_bytes ( self, g_variant_get_uint64 (value)); } else if (g_str_equal (key, PROPERTY_TX_BYTES)) { mm_bearer_stats_set_tx_bytes ( self, g_variant_get_uint64 (value)); } g_free (key); g_variant_unref (value); } return self; } /*****************************************************************************/ MMBearerStats * mm_bearer_stats_new (void) { return (MM_BEARER_STATS (g_object_new (MM_TYPE_BEARER_STATS, NULL))); } static void mm_bearer_stats_init (MMBearerStats *self) { self->priv = G_TYPE_INSTANCE_GET_PRIVATE (self, MM_TYPE_BEARER_STATS, MMBearerStatsPrivate); } static void mm_bearer_stats_class_init (MMBearerStatsClass *klass) { GObjectClass *object_class = G_OBJECT_CLASS (klass); g_type_class_add_private (object_class, sizeof (MMBearerStatsPrivate)); }
